## Service Accounts — Relay Gateway (Murkfen)

The murkfen-relay service account handles websocket fan-out. Per-message deflate is disabled: CPU cost on the edge pods outweighed the ~30% bandwidth savings at our payload sizes (<2 KB). If payloads grow past 8 KB, revisit. Context takeover is off regardless — memory per connection spikes otherwise.

Do not enable compression per-tenant; it fragments the connection pool metrics. The account authenticates against the Bramble auth tier. Use the key below for local testing only.

gateway credential: qvz4-W8Ni

MEMO — Expansion into the Soren Coast Region
To: Sales Leads
From: Priya Handal, Commercial Director, Quillbrook Foods

Following eighteen months of market analysis, we will open distribution in the Soren Coast region beginning next quarter. Initial coverage targets the Halvery and Tennick corridors, supported by two regional reps and a dedicated merchandising budget. Pricing tiers mirror the Westvale model with minor freight adjustments. One sensitive element is set out immediately below.

board note of bawep-tajef: Queniusek Systems plans to raise the Quenvan list price by 53.1 percent in March. The pricing group signed off on a budget of $176.4 million for Project Drueth. The renewal with Casionix Partners closes at $142.5 million a year, 8.3 percent below the last contract. Project Fraax slips by six weeks because of the tooling delay.

**Re: tailkit follow mode**

Don't hardcode the poll interval in `follow.go`. Tailkit's backends vary — Grelling cluster logs rotate fast, archive tiers don't. Move these into the shared config struct so ops can override per-environment. Also cap the read buffer; we had an OOM last quarter from an unbounded tail on a 40GB file. Use the defaults below as your starting point.

tuning table, kajog-kawef:
PRIORITIES = {
    "kelox": 870,
    "kasix": 89,
    "eliax": 988,
}